In Exercises 107 and 108, determine whether or not there exists a function f(x, y)with the given partial derivatives. Explain your reasoning. If such a function exists, give an example.

\(f_{x}(x, y)=-3 \sin (3 x-2 y), f_{y}(x, y)=2 \sin (3 x-2 y)\)
